Klocwork Quality Standard community Java checker reference
List of community Java checkers that focus on improving overall code quality.
Issue code | Description | Severity | Enabled | Issued | Improved |
---|---|---|---|---|---|
JAVA.DANGEROUS_CAST | Dangerous cast used | 4 | false | 2020.1 | |
JAVA.HIDDEN.MEMBER.LOCAL | Class data member is hidden by a local variable | 4 | false | 2020.1 | |
JAVA.HIDDEN.PARAM.LOCAL | Class data member is hidden by a method parameter | 4 | false | 2020.1 | |
JAVA.MAGIC.CHAR | Magic number used:Char | 4 | false | 2020.1 | |
JAVA.MAGIC.NUMBER | Magic number used:Number | 4 | false | 2020.1 | |
JAVA.MAGIC.STRING | Magic number used:String | 4 | false | 2020.1 | |
JAVA.STMT.DO.BLOCK | Body for do statement should be a block | 4 | false | 2020.1 | |
JAVA.STMT.FOR.BLOCK | Body for for statement should be a block | 4 | false | 2020.1 | |
JAVA.STMT.IFELSE.BLOCK | Body for If/Else statement should be a block | 4 | false | 2020.1 | |
JAVA.STMT.WHILE.BLOCK | Body for while statement should be a block | 4 | false | 2020.1 | |
JAVA.SWITCH.DEFAULT.POSITION | default label not appear in the first or the last in switch statement | 4 | false | 2020.1 | |
JAVA.SWITCH.NOBREAK | Switch case phrase should be ends with break | 4 | false | 2020.1 | |
JAVA.SWITCH.NODEFAULT | No default label in switch statement | 4 | false | 2020.1 | |
JAVA.UNINIT.LOCAL_VAR | Unitinalized local variable | 4 | false | 2020.1 | |
JAVA.UNINIT.LOOP_COUNTER | Uninitialized loop counter in for statement | 4 | false | 2020.1 |